Åke Holm (1900-80) was an artist and ceramicist based at Hoganas, Sweden. He often used biblical themes in his work but with a distinct modernist styling. Between 1966 and 1980 he produced a series of limited edition runs of these linocut prints. To date around 275 different images are know. His work is starting to get the recognition it deserves for its distinctive style. The museum in Hoganas holds a large collection of his work donated by the artist.
